Construction Management Fundamentals provides an integrated overview of the fundamentals of construction in a logical, simple, and concise format. Numerous examples are used in the text to reinforce construction and management concepts. These include application details, photographs, and illustrations derived from actual projects. Based upon professional practice, standard formats for analyzing common problems are presented and explained. Such formats prepare students for fast-paced bid preparation where attention to detail is critically important. This updated third edition has been revised to reflect The National Academy of Construction (NAC), the American Society of Civil Engineers (ASCE) and ABET revised construction curriculum requirements to include Building Information Modeling/3-D Modeling and understanding 4D modeling. - Intended for use in an undergraduate Civil Engineering curriculum or for graduate courses in Construction Management. - The text covers the fundamentals of construction in a logical, simple, and concise format, and many examples reinforce construction and management concepts through applications, photographs, and illustrations derived from actual projects - Meets the newly revised curriculum requirements (ASCE, NAC, and ABET) to include Building Information Modeling, 3-D modeling, and an understanding of 4-D modeling
